Florida-based Brown & Brown Inc. announced it has acquired commercial property and casualty insurance agency Bartos-Hunsicker Inc., of Bethlehem, Pa., in a transaction effective June 1, 2003.
Bartos-Hunsicker has annualized revenues of approximately $800,000, and serves businesses and homeowners throughout Pennsylvania and New Jersey. President Wayne Dubbs, Randy Hartranft and their staff will be combining their operations with Brown & Brown’s existing Bethlehem location.
Thomas E. Riley, regional executive vice president of Brown & Brown, who is responsible for Brown & Brown’s operations in the Northeastern U. S., said, “We are pleased to have Wayne, Randy and their staff of insurance professionals join us. Their operation adds strength to our Lehigh Valley area presence and provides an important addition in our goal to better serve the insurance needs of the residents and businesses of this growing region.”
